Charming Historic Lompoc Home. Central Coast Wine Country, Pet Friendly
1930s Tudor style house with many original details. Decorated to reflect both the original era built and modern tastes, the house and fenced in yard are dog friendly. 4 Bedrooms and two beautifully tiled full bathrooms. Three of the bedrooms have queen beds and the upstairs front bedroom is set up with two twin beds for flexibility.
Within 3 block walking distance of old town Lompoc, breweries, cafes and wine. Just a 5 minute drive to Lompoc's "Wine Ghetto" https://explorelompoc.com/lompoc-wine-ghetto/ and 10-15 minutes from some of Santa Barbara wine countries best and most beautiful vineyards and estates. Host will happily provide you a list of their favorite wineries, breweries, dining opportunities, adventure opportunities and more.
Fully equipped kitchen with new stove (not pictured). Also new washer/dryer units (not pictured)
Large fenced in back yard is perfect for entertaining and has a Weber Grill for BBQing.
Parking is all done on street with parking usually available directly in front of the house.

Lompoc is the Central Coast's best kept secret! It boasts some of the best weather year round, with much milder temperatures than our inland neigbours. As well, the longtime Lompoc folks are some of the kindest, most genuine people you will get to know. We were charmed from the very first!
What makes this property unique
A bit of history, our home is a grand old lady. South H Street is quiet and neighbors are lovely. The stone pines lining the wide street give you a feel for neighborhoods from a different time.
See if you can find some of the unique features that can often be found in older homes...a dairy delivery door... a laundry chute, built in shoe racks, and more.
